What Are Professional Gutters?
Professional gutters describe premium, custom-installed gutter systems developed to handle rainwater effectively. They can be found in various materials, shapes, and sizes, customized to fulfill the specific needs of a home. Professional installation ensures that gutters not only operate successfully however also match the home's architecture.

Significance of Professional Gutter Installation
Buying professional gutter installation comes with a myriad of benefits:
- Proper Functionality: Professionals guarantee that gutters are installed at the appropriate pitch, which is essential for effective drainage.
- Longevity: High-quality materials and professional installation increase the lifespan of the gutter system.
- Aesthetic Value: A correctly set up gutter system boosts the visual appeal of a home, including to its total worth.
- Prevent Water Damage: Effective gutters avoid water from pooling around the foundation, decreasing the threat of mold and structural damage.

2. Climate
Consider the climate condition in your location. For circumstances, areas with heavy rains might need more robust and larger systems to manage increased water circulation. Alternatively, areas with minimal rains may just need basic gutters.
3. Downspout Placement
Proper downspout placement is vital for reliable drainage. Professionals can evaluate your home's layout and recommend the best locations, ensuring that water is directed far from the structure.
4. Visual Compatibility
Gutters ought to complement your home's architecture. Factors such as color, material, and style ought to match other exterior components for a cohesive look.
5. Spending plan
Establish a budget plan before purchasing gutters. Costs can differ commonly based upon products, types, and installation. It's a good idea to invest in quality, as less expensive choices might lead to higher maintenance expenses in the long run.
Professional Gutter Maintenance Tips
To guarantee that gutters stay practical and efficient, routine maintenance is necessary. Here are some professional suggestions:
- Regular Cleaning: Clear particles such as leaves and branches from gutters a minimum of twice a year, particularly throughout fall.
- Inspect for Damage: Regularly look for rust, fractures, or loose sections and repair or change them immediately.
- Check Downspouts: Ensure downspouts are clear and directing water far from the structure.
- Examine for Leaks: Look for indications of leaks, which can suggest that the gutter system is not functioning correctly.
- Arrange Professional Inspections: Consider working with a professional to carry out comprehensive assessments annually, particularly after severe weather condition.
FAQ about Professional Gutters
1. How often should I clean my gutters?
Cleaning gutters ought to ideally be done a minimum of two times a year, once in spring and as soon as in fall. In website with heavy foliage, more frequent cleaning might be necessary.
2. What occurs if I do not preserve my gutters?
Ignoring gutter maintenance can cause water damage, mold growth, and structural issues in your home. Clogged gutters can overflow, triggering water to pool around the foundation.
3. Are seamless gutters worth the financial investment?
Yes, seamless gutters lower the threat of leakages considering that they are customized to fit your home. While they may cost more initially, their toughness and decreased maintenance requirements can save money with time.
4. Can I set up gutters myself?
While DIY gutter installation is possible, professional installation is suggested to ensure proper function and prevent common mistakes that could lead to pricey repairs.
5. How do I know what size gutters I require?
The size of gutters needed depends on the roof size, rains intensity in your area, and the pitch of the roof. Consulting a professional can supply customized suggestions based upon your specific scenario.
